Fix for: Is there a way to have an outlook 2007 email template automatically update the subject with the current date?
Low Risk
Select Design a Form. from the Tools\Forms menu In the Standard Forms Library Open the Message form. This will open a standard mail form. Right-click on the Subject text input box and select Properties. From the Properties dialogue box click on the …
